The Federation of Noida Residents Welfare Association has sent a circular to resident welfare bodies of all the sectors seeking a complete ban on polythene bags in their respective areas. The Federation of Noida RWAs has urged individual RWA leaders of the city to keep a vigil in the market areas under their jurisdiction.

On the other hand, the Noida Federation of Apartment Owners Association (NOFAA) is spreading awareness in individual residential societies about the benefits of using jute and paper bags in place of plastic bags.

Rajiva Singh, president of NOFAA informed City Spidey that on a weekly basis NOFAA members will conduct meetings with different Apartment Owner Associations of the city to sensitise them against the use of polythene and plastic. “Some societies have already fully abandoned the use of plastic bags. These are Overseas Apartment, Windsor Greens and Stellar Kings in Sector 50,” Singh added.  

NP Singh, president, Federation of Noida Residents Welfare Association stated, “Through our circular, we have requested all RWAs to undertake earnest measures that will result in a polythene-free Noida.”

The circular has a four-pronged mandate:

1. RWAs should hold regular meetings with residents to educate them about the harmful effects of polythene.

2. Pamphlets on the adverse effects of polythene to be distributed in all residential and commercial sectors.

3. RWAs to organise awareness marches in their respective sectors.

4. Notices and hoardings, cautioning people about the use of plastic, to be put up in all residential sectors. RWAs to instruct/urge all shopkeepers to comply with the ban.
